Radome
//ˈɹeɪ.dəʊm// noun
noun ·Rare ·Advanced level
Definitions
Noun
- 1 A radar dome.
"Radar antennas were distributed in large quantities throughout the base, half of them in white radomes that looked as if some gigantic bird had laid a clutch of eggs at random."
- 2 a housing for a radar antenna; transparent to radio waves wordnet

Etymology
Blend of radar + dome, originating from the 1940s.
